Xavier wasn't "an old guy", he just looks old because he lost his hair, which is caused by his mutant powers and not age.

The subject just came up recently on Usenet and I did this calculation:

The OHOTMU page
http://marvel.com/universe/Professor_X says he entered college at age 16 and
graduated in two years at 18.

At this point we no longer have exact numbers. He went to Oxford and met
Moira MacTaggert. Let's say two years (he didn't finish).

Assume one more year for the military. One more for meeting Gabrielle Haller
and Magneto. Then finishing graduate studies at Columbia and psychiatry in
London (add two years each, since he's a comic book genius).

He then meets Jean prior to X-Men #1, at which point Jean is 10 and he's 26.


I suppose it's still a big enough difference to be creepy, but it's still nowhere near what it looks like. And I'm pretty sure all this backstory wasn't planned at the time of X-Men #1 and he could actually have been intended to be close to Jean's age.
